I am curious if anyone has found a good shopping cart for multiple warehouses. We operate 3 warehouses plus we drop ship some items directly from manufacturers. Ideally, I am looking for software which will allow customers to go through a single checkout and calculate shipping based on which warehouse or manufacturer items ship from. When orders are placed, each warehouse (or manufacturer) would receive a packing slip for their items (vendors should receive a PO but I can work around this).

We are currently looking at SunShop and X-Cart Pro. Has anyone had much experience with either of these especially as it relates to shipping from multiple locations. Or can you recommend another package?

Thanks for any input.

CRE Loaded is planning on offering a number of the features we need but we need them now. Like ZenCart, they plan on rewriting a lot of the code and, in fact, have rewritten some.  Zen Cart appears to have the advantage in that their approach looks like it will be more in line with what osC is doing with MS3.

I used to design computer software and I know exactly what I want (and what we, in fact, provided even 20+ years ago for our clients). None of the shopping cart providers have a really good jobwith addressing multi-location inventories. In particular, none that I have seen recognize that I want to sell a single SKU in more than one location. So far, it appears that I will need to create slightly different SKUs for the items that we stock in multiple locations.

X-Cart Pro has a seems to be running in front but need to install their trial to really see how many hoops we will have to jump through. I sent them a list of questions in the hope of clarifying a number of our issues.
